Machine translation:
Deputy head of Zelensky's office Kyrylo Tymoshenko wrote a letter of resignation, Ukrainian media report

Earlier, the media reported that the Ukrainian Anti-Corruption Agency was checking Tymoshenko's cars, as he took a Chevrolet Tahoe SUV for travel, donated by American GM for humanitarian needs, and also drives an expensive Porsche.

Journalists who wrote about Porsche added that the official lives in an elite village near Kyiv, which the publication calls “the main settlement of Ukrainian millionaires.”

People's Deputy Yaroslav Zheleznyak has already confirmed the information about the dismissal of the deputy head of Zelensky's office Tymoshenko and said that Deputy Prosecutor General Symonenko had been dismissed. According to Zheleznyak, there will be at least three more personnel decisions closer to February.

Zelensky said in an evening address that he signed a number of important decrees, including the adoption of "important personnel decisions that concern managers at various levels in the center and in the regions,
